First opened in 1875. Housed Enrico Caruso on the night of April 17-18, 1906, when the fabled San Francisco earthquake and fire occured. He swore never to return to San Francisco. The hotel was gutted, and did not reopen until 1909. Has a Maxfield Parrish mural in the Pied Piper Bar. The Garden Court dining room is the elegant heart of the establishment, with marble columns and stained glass dome. Was once managed by my grandfather, Babe Thacker. Now owned and run by the Sheraton Hotel chain.
